Recognizing Separation in Texas: The Structure
Before diving into the specifics of a Denton Texas separation, it's necessary to comprehend the fundamental regulations controling marital relationship dissolution throughout the Lone Star State. Texas provides both "no-fault" and "fault-based" premises for divorce:
No-Fault Separation (Insupportability): The most common ground, insisting that the marital relationship has actually come to be "insupportable" as a result of disharmony or dispute, without any reasonable assumption of settlement. This prevents criticizing either event and often brings about a less controversial procedure.
Fault-Based Separation: While less usual for the whole divorce, Texas legislation also recognizes fault premises, which can sometimes affect building division or spousal maintenance. These include adultery, viciousness, abandonment (for at the very least one year), felony sentence (with jail time for a minimum of one year), and arrest in a mental hospital (for a minimum of 3 years with long shot of recuperation).
Residency Demands
To apply for separation in Texas, specific residency demands have to be satisfied:
A minimum of one spouse has to have resided in Texas for a constant six-month period.
Furthermore, at the very least one spouse needs to have stayed in the region where the divorce is filed for at the very least 90 days. This indicates if you are applying for a Denton Area separation, either you or your partner must have resided in Denton County for a minimum of 90 days.
The Denton Region Separation Process: What to Expect
When residency requirements are satisfied, the Denton County divorce procedure starts with filing the initial paperwork.
1. Filing the Petition
The first step is to submit an " Initial Request for Separation" with the Area Staff's office in Denton County. Since 2025, the declaring cost is usually between $350 and $400, though it's always a good idea to validate the specific amount with the District Staff's office, situated at 1450 E McKinney Road, 1st Floor, Denton, TX 76209. E-filing is also an readily available and progressively usual approach for sending papers.
2. Solution of Process
After the request is submitted, your partner needs to be officially informed of the separation process. This is known as "service of process." Choices consist of:
Formal Solution: Used by a constable, sheriff, or private process-server.
Qualified Mail: Papers sent by means of certified divorce in Denton County mail with a return receipt.
Waiver of Service: If your spouse agrees to the divorce and coordinates, they can sign a Waiver of Service, staying clear of the requirement for official solution and commonly expediting the procedure.
3. The Mandatory Waiting Period
Texas regulation mandates a 60-day waiting duration from the date the Original Request for Divorce is submitted prior to a separation can be completed. This period allows pairs time to reconsider, work out terms, or finalize arrangements without undue haste. Even in the most amicable and uncontested situations, this 60-day minimum needs to be observed.
4. Exploration and Details Celebration
Throughout the separation process, both celebrations engage in "discovery," which involves trading economic and individual details appropriate to the divorce. This can include:
Financial declarations, bank accounts, financial investments
Residential or commercial property actions, automobile titles
Financial debt declarations ( home mortgages, bank card, loans).
Info related to kids (medical, school documents).
Full disclosure is crucial in Texas, a community property state. All properties and financial obligations obtained during the marital relationship are taken into consideration neighborhood residential or commercial property and undergo a just and reasonable department by the court. Attempting to hide possessions can result in serious penalties from the court.
5. Short-term Orders.
Oftentimes, specifically those including children or intricate financial situations, the court may release " Short-term Orders" early while doing so. These orders develop rules for youngster custody, visitation, child support, spousal support, and temporary use of building while the divorce is pending. They ensure security and provide a structure for every day life throughout the often-lengthy divorce proceedings.
6. Negotiation and Arbitration.
Most separations in Denton Area, and Texas all at once, are resolved through settlement and mediation instead of a complete test.
Negotiation: Spouses ( usually through their attorneys) function to get to shared arrangements on all aspects of the divorce.
Mediation: A neutral third-party moderator assists in conversations between the spouses, helping them discover commonalities and get to a equally acceptable negotiation. Arbitration is frequently required in opposed instances and is extremely efficient in resolving conflicts amicably, which can save time, cash, and emotional anxiety.
7. The Final Decree of Divorce and Prove-Up.
If spouses reach a full agreement, they will certainly authorize an "Agreed Decree of Separation." This thorough paper outlines all terms, consisting of child guardianship and assistance setups, spousal upkeep (alimony), and the division of community residential or commercial property and financial debts.
As soon as the 60-day waiting duration has passed and all terms are agreed upon, the instance proceeds to a "Prove-Up" hearing. For uncontested separations in Denton County, these hearings are frequently quick and can often be sent electronically without the demand for an in-person court appearance. The court evaluates the Agreed Decree to guarantee it complies with Texas legislation and is in the most effective interest of any children involved. Upon authorization, the court signs the Final Decree of Separation, officially liquifying the marital relationship.
